簡體   English   中英

Logstash 管道數據未推送到 Elasticsearch

[英]Logstash pipeline data is not pushed to Elasticsearch

輸入 { 在此處輸入圖像描述

文件 {

    path => "/home/blusapphire/padma/sampledata.csv"

    start_position => "beginning"

    }

}

篩選 {

 csv {

   columns => [ "First_Name", "Last_Name", "Age", "Salary", "Emailid", "Gender" ]

    }

}

output {

elasticsearch {

      hosts => ["${ES_INGEST_HOST_02}:9200"]

      index => "network"

      user  => "adcd"

      password => "adcbdems"  
}    

}

這是我的 logstash 配置文件,當運行 logstash 文件時,我在 Elasticsearch 中看不到數據(給出 csv),並且沒有創建索引,配置中是否有任何錯誤?

根據您的屏幕截圖,很明顯 logstash 已經注意到您的文件。 要讓 logstash 感覺它正在與文件進行“第一次接觸”,請嘗試:

  1. 關閉logstash
  2. 刪除 since_db 文件
  3. 啟動logstash

或者,將文件移出受監控的文件夾,執行上述步驟,然后將文件放入。

您是否還可以確認您的設置適用於其他文件 - 以防萬一?

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M